Completed in 2000 (the same year as his third feature-length work, BACK AGAINST THE WALL), James Fotopoulos' THE SUN is a 16mm silent short that beguilingly cross-cuts between a lovely young woman, uncomfortably waiting, and the sun-drenched outdoors. Between these two seemingly unrelated sequences, a tension develops. Without the assistance of a soundtrack as a guide, anything imaginable could be possible. Or nothing at all. THE SUN is another remarkable selection from the Cinemad Almanac.
